a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/de/hysky/skyblocker/config
diff options
context:
space:
mode:
authorolim <bobq4582@gmail.com>2024-02-08 16:35:29 +0000
committerolim <bobq4582@gmail.com>2024-02-08 16:35:29 +0000
commit91ce7cff49db6df844900dd4a9c405747ff4935a (patch)
tree3c8e5abf7a4b499139ad1ac5151ba3f776b62bac /src/main/java/de/hysky/skyblocker/config
parent7a0635b4f7825ac335e79e4ec738cefcce47c2f2 (diff)
downloadSkyblocker-91ce7cff49db6df844900dd4a9c405747ff4935a.tar.gz
Skyblocker-91ce7cff49db6df844900dd4a9c405747ff4935a.tar.bz2
Skyblocker-91ce7cff49db6df844900dd4a9c405747ff4935a.zip
add commands to open seach
add /bzs to search bazaar and /ahs to search ah
Diffstat (limited to 'src/main/java/de/hysky/skyblocker/config')
-rw-r--r--src/main/java/de/hysky/skyblocker/config/SkyblockerConfig.java3
-rw-r--r--src/main/java/de/hysky/skyblocker/config/categories/GeneralCategory.java8
2 files changed, 11 insertions, 0 deletions
diff --git a/src/main/java/de/hysky/skyblocker/config/SkyblockerConfig.java b/src/main/java/de/hysky/skyblocker/config/SkyblockerConfig.java
index 7a9cb721..fd548d6a 100644
--- a/src/main/java/de/hysky/skyblocker/config/SkyblockerConfig.java
+++ b/src/main/java/de/hysky/skyblocker/config/SkyblockerConfig.java
@@ -431,6 +431,9 @@ public class SkyblockerConfig {
public int historyLength = 3;
@SerialEntry
+ public boolean enableCommands = false;
+
+ @SerialEntry
public List<String> bazaarHistory = new ArrayList<>();
@SerialEntry
diff --git a/src/main/java/de/hysky/skyblocker/config/categories/GeneralCategory.java b/src/main/java/de/hysky/skyblocker/config/categories/GeneralCategory.java
index 4abf7836..3d7f63ce 100644
--- a/src/main/java/de/hysky/skyblocker/config/categories/GeneralCategory.java
+++ b/src/main/java/de/hysky/skyblocker/config/categories/GeneralCategory.java
@@ -686,6 +686,14 @@ public class GeneralCategory {
newValue -> config.general.searchOverlay.historyLength = newValue)
.controller(opt -> IntegerSliderControllerBuilder.create(opt).range(0, 5).step(1))
.build())
+ .option(Option.<Boolean>createBuilder()
+ .name(Text.translatable("text.autoconfig.skyblocker.option.general.searchOverlay.enableCommands"))
+ .description(OptionDescription.of(Text.translatable("text.autoconfig.skyblocker.option.general.searchOverlay.enableCommands.@Tooltip")))
+ .binding(defaults.general.searchOverlay.enableCommands,
+ () -> config.general.searchOverlay.enableCommands,
+ newValue -> config.general.searchOverlay.enableCommands = newValue)
+ .controller(ConfigUtils::createBooleanController)
+ .build())
.build())
.build();
}